Pergunta

Eu estou procurando uma solução para a captura de áudio do microfone de um usuário e publicá-la (preferencialmente como MP3) para um servidor. Eu preciso de algo que eu pode incorporar em uma página da web.

Eu vi onde o Flash pode fazer isso, mas eu entendo que esta abordagem exige software do lado do servidor caro a partir de Adobe. Eu não estou ciente de se Silverlight pode fornecer qualquer capacidade para ajudar com isso.

Estou curioso o que outros fizeram. Qualquer conselho seria muito apreciado.

Foi útil?

Solução

Você pode fazê-lo com o Flash e quer Red5 ou haXeVideo ou o servidor, tanto Open Source. Em relação oferecendo um MP3 final para o usuário, você vai precisar de algo mais, porque essas 2 ferramentas única gravar para o formato FLV devido às licenças necessárias para MP3s codificam. Você pode usar algo no servidor, como FFMPEG para a transformação, mas ainda assim, ler as letras pequenas em relação MP3s .

Boa sorte

Juan

Outras dicas

Silverlight 4 agora tem a capacidade de gravar áudio. http://blog.ondrejsv.com/post/Audio- gravador-Silverlight-4-Sample.aspx mostra que codificam PCM para WAV

Silverlight não tem essa capacidade, atualmente (ou em sua próxima versão 3.0). Flash seria o caminho a percorrer.

Licenciado em: CC-BY-SA com atribuição
Não afiliado a StackOverflow
scroll top